Subject: Trailscope handover

Team,

Owning Trailscope (audit-log viewer) releases passes to you this sprint. Basics: weekly cut, Thursday freeze, Friday ship. Pipeline: build, sign, stage, smoke, promote. Known flaky test: log-pagination-e2e; rerun once before escalating. Rollbacks are one command; doc is in the repo wiki. Access requests go through Priya's team. Don't skip the signing step — unsigned builds are rejected at the gateway. The deploy key you'll need for the promote stage follows.

deploy key for kaduf-bagep: bky6_NNeq4d

## Runbook: Quillfax Invoice Renderer — Restart Procedure

Before restarting the renderer, confirm no invoice batches are mid-generation; a forced stop can leave partially written PDFs in the spool directory, which must then be manually purged. The renderer runs under a restricted service account with read-only access to templates. After restart, verify the sandbox flag is enabled before resuming traffic. The configuration the service loads at boot is shown below.

config for yajep-tafof:
[rusath]
team = julmir
access_code = ac_fe37fd
host = rusath.novactech.test
port = 8000
owner = pelmir.weneth
peer = oliwyn.olvarqdyn.internal

Ticket: Driftbay vault locked itself again after the lint migration. Context for newcomers: our SQL linter (Slatecheck) now enforces uppercase keywords and explicit JOINs, and the migration job that applies rules to the warehouse reads its creds from the Driftbay vault. Three failed unseal attempts from the CI runner tripped the lockout. To unseal manually, open the vault console and enter the recovery passphrase, which I'm pasting below for convenience.

unlock words, yawig-kagef: gordor-holvan-ulaael-pramir-ulaiel-tamdor

LEADERSHIP REVIEW BRIEFING

Subject: Launch Plan — Quillbase 4.0
Prepared for: Heads of Department

Quillbase 4.0 launches in three phases: a closed pilot with twelve design partners, a regional rollout in Varento, then general availability eight weeks later. Marketing assets are in final review; support staffing is confirmed. Pricing will be announced at pilot exit, not before. Department heads should confirm readiness by end of month. The underlying commercial intent is set out directly below.

internal memo for kawip-hadug: Headcount on the Wenwyn team goes from 7 to 140 by the end of January. Gross margin on Wenwyn came in at 20 percent against a plan of 15 percent.